Grilled Pork Chops

Ingredients:
- 4 bone-in pork chops
- 2 cloves of garlic, minced
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 2 tablespoons soy sauce
- 1 tablespoon brown sugar
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- Salt and pepper, to taste
Instructions:
- In a small bowl, mix together the garlic, olive oil, soy sauce, brown sugar, thyme, salt, and pepper.
- Place the pork chops in a large resealable bag and pour the marinade over the chops. Seal the bag and toss to coat the chops evenly.
- Marinate the pork chops in the refrigerator for at least 1 hour, or up to 8 hours.
- Preheat your grill to medium-high heat.
- Remove the pork chops from the marinade and discard the remaining marinade.
- Season the pork chops with a little extra salt and pepper, if desired.
- Grill the pork chops for 6-8 minutes per side, or until the internal temperature reaches 145°F.
- Remove the pork chops from the grill and let them rest for 5 minutes before serving.
This recipe is a classic one that’s easy to make and packed with flavor. The marinade gives the pork chops a nice savory and sweet taste, while the thyme and garlic add an extra depth of flavor. These pork chops are perfect for a summertime cookout and go well with any side dishes.
